The Patient Was Strapped in for 43 Hours. The Room Temperature Was Around 40 Degrees Celsius.

Summary by Onet
A patient at a psychiatric hospital in Lublin was strapped to his bed for 43 hours. Staff say the man was aggressive. On the morning of July 1, a doctor pronounced him dead. The circumstances of his death are being investigated by the prosecutor's office.
